Transaction 95db00330bc82da13f44020c2275d5dde6c23a60690cf13f63a67500d3e78edb
1 Input
2 Outputs
- 95db00330bc82da13f44020c2275d5dde6c23a60690cf13f63a67500d3e78edb:0
- 95db00330bc82da13f44020c2275d5dde6c23a60690cf13f63a67500d3e78edb:1
value 2000000
address 1C5tL2rjFprVYLrPH6vykiDS9Z1SMSFwvJ
value 17143095
address 12VG3jSbcKh14cvhuXtgxkV8rF4SU77tk8